**Q: How do I register a custom validator plugin with Verdicta?**

Drop your plugin manifest into the `validators.d` directory and declare the schema versions it handles. Verdicta loads plugins at startup, sandboxes each one, and rejects any that mutate input records. Conflicts between plugins are resolved by priority field, lowest wins. If your plugin needs access to the signed fixture vault for conformance tests, unlock it with the recovery passphrase, which is provided on the line below.

vault phrase of bagaf-kajeg = jorath-feniel-briir-siliel-ralix

Ticket: Config drift in Sketchwren undo/redo

Welcome aboard! Quick context: the Sketchwren diagram editor's undo stack depth differs between staging and prod, so testers keep hitting "history exhausted" errors that nobody can reproduce locally. Someone hand-edited prod months ago and it never got committed. To fix the drift, please align every environment to the canonical values below.

service settings:
PRAIX_LOG_LEVEL=error
PRAIX_METRICS_HOST=metrics.praix.qorvelcorp.corp
PRAIX_POOL_SIZE=16

Hi Marit,

Before you review the slimming PR, some context from yesterday's disaster-recovery drill. We rebuilt all production images from the trimmed base layers after simulating registry loss. Everything restored cleanly except the `ledger-sync` image, where the slimmed variant dropped the CA bundle — my PR fixes that by pinning the certs stage.

Please verify the restore path yourself: pull the drill registry, run the rebuild script, and when the sealed manifest prompts for recovery, enter the passphrase below.

vault phrase of tajop-haduf = holath-brivan-wenax

Action item: Garage occupancy feed from the Marwick lot dropped to zero for 90 minutes post-deploy because the sensor gateway rejected the new auth token format. Release manager must gate future feed-service deploys on the synthetic occupancy check passing for two consecutive intervals. Add this check to the release checklist before the next cut. Rollback procedure and check configuration are documented on the internal page below.

wiki page, tahaf-tajog: https://jira.ordindyn.corp/pipeline